数字孪生大屏项目如何实现数据实时更新?
数字孪生大屏项目如何实现数据实时更新?
随着大数据、云计算、物联网等技术的不断发展,数字孪生技术逐渐成为各行各业数字化转型的重要手段。数字孪生大屏项目作为数字孪生技术在可视化领域的应用,其核心价值在于实现对现实世界的实时监测、分析和决策。然而,如何实现数字孪生大屏项目的数据实时更新,成为众多企业和开发者关注的焦点。本文将从以下几个方面探讨数字孪生大屏项目实现数据实时更新的方法。
一、数据采集
数据采集是数字孪生大屏项目实现数据实时更新的基础。以下是几种常见的数据采集方式:
物联网传感器:通过物联网传感器实时采集设备运行状态、环境参数等数据,如温度、湿度、压力等。
数据接口:利用现有系统或平台提供的数据接口,如API、Web服务等方式获取数据。
人工采集:通过人工录入、拍照、扫描等方式获取数据。
第三方数据服务:利用第三方数据服务提供商提供的数据,如天气预报、交通状况等。
二、数据处理
数据采集后,需要对数据进行处理,以满足数字孪生大屏项目的需求。以下是几种常见的数据处理方式:
数据清洗:去除无效、错误、重复的数据,保证数据质量。
数据整合:将来自不同来源的数据进行整合,形成统一的数据格式。
数据转换:将原始数据转换为适合数字孪生大屏项目展示的格式,如图表、地图等。
数据分析:对数据进行统计分析、趋势预测等,为决策提供依据。
三、数据传输
数据传输是数字孪生大屏项目实现数据实时更新的关键环节。以下是几种常见的数据传输方式:
物联网协议:如MQTT、CoAP等,适用于低功耗、高可靠性的场景。
RESTful API:通过HTTP请求进行数据传输,适用于互联网环境。
WebSocket:支持全双工通信,实时性较好。
数据总线:如OPC UA、MODBUS等,适用于工业自动化领域。
四、数据展示
数据展示是数字孪生大屏项目的最终目标。以下是几种常见的数据展示方式:
图表:如柱状图、折线图、饼图等,直观展示数据变化趋势。
地图:利用地图展示地理信息,如交通状况、气象灾害等。
3D可视化:通过三维模型展示设备、建筑等实体,增强视觉效果。
动态效果:如动画、闪烁等,提高数据展示的吸引力。
五、系统架构
数字孪生大屏项目实现数据实时更新,需要构建一个高效、稳定的系统架构。以下是几种常见的系统架构:
分布式架构:将数据采集、处理、传输、展示等模块分散部署,提高系统可扩展性和可靠性。
微服务架构:将系统拆分为多个独立的服务,便于开发和维护。
云计算架构:利用云计算平台提供的数据存储、计算、网络等资源,实现弹性扩展。
物联网架构:利用物联网技术实现设备、传感器等实时数据采集和传输。
总结
数字孪生大屏项目实现数据实时更新,需要从数据采集、处理、传输、展示等方面进行综合考虑。通过合理的数据采集方式、高效的数据处理技术、稳定的数据传输方式以及丰富的数据展示手段,构建一个高效、稳定的数字孪生大屏项目,为企业、政府等用户提供实时、精准的决策依据。
猜你喜欢:搅拌浸出